Abstract

The important time ordering properties of a three time correlation function C3τ12τ3 are evaluated as well as Mandel's Q parameter. It is shown that the relation between the function and line shape fluctuations described by Q generalizes the Wiener-Khintchine theorem, that relates the averaged line shape and the one time dipole correlation function.
